Cornyn joins Texas business push for legislation to give ‘Dreamers’ permanent legal status
Dallas Morning News, Mar 15, 2021

Texas alone is home to more than 100,000 Dreamers, those unauthorized immigrants who were brought to the U.S. as children

A new Texas business coalition is urging Congress to pass legislation that would provide permanent legal status to “Dreamers” — those unauthorized immigrants, including more than 100,000 in Texas alone, who were brought to the U.S. as children.

The Texas Opportunity Coalition launched Tuesday with support from Texas Sen. John Cornyn, a Republican whose vote would be key for any such measure to succeed in the Senate.

Cornyn said that “after years of being yanked around from court ruling to court ruling” over DACA, the Deferred Action for Childhood Arrivals program launched by former President Barack Obama, “these young men and women deserve certainty to be able to plan their future.”

“The only way to do that is through legislation,” Cornyn said in a taped statement played at a virtual news conference.
